Organic SEO is the process of improving a website’s ranking in search engines without paid advertising. It works by optimizing content, keywords, technical structure, backlinks, and user experience so search engines can understand and rank your site. Organic SEO helps websites attract free and consistent traffic over time.
Organic SEO is important because it brings long-term traffic, builds credibility, and reduces advertising costs. Businesses using Organic SEO can rank naturally in search results and attract targeted users who are actively searching for their services, leading to better conversions and sustainable online growth.
Organic SEO usually takes 3 to 6 months to show noticeable results, depending on competition, keyword difficulty, and website quality. Consistent content creation, technical optimization, and backlink building help improve rankings faster and ensure long-term visibility in search engine results.
The main steps in Organic SEO include keyword research, on-page SEO, high-quality content creation, technical SEO, backlink building, user experience optimization, local SEO, and performance tracking. These steps help search engines understand your website and improve its ranking for relevant keywords.
Organic SEO focuses on ranking naturally through content and optimization, while paid SEO (PPC or ads) requires advertising budgets to appear in sponsored results. Organic SEO builds long-term traffic and credibility, whereas paid SEO provides instant visibility but stops when the budget ends.
To improve Organic SEO ranking, focus on high-quality content, proper keyword research, fast website speed, mobile optimization, internal linking, and strong backlinks. Regularly updating content and fixing technical issues also helps search engines rank your website faster and improve overall performance.
Common Organic SEO mistakes include keyword stuffing, thin content, slow website speed, poor technical SEO, broken links, and lack of backlinks. Avoiding these issues and focusing on user-friendly content and proper optimization helps improve rankings and ensures better search engine visibility.
Organic SEO is better for long-term growth because it provides continuous traffic without ongoing ad spending. Paid advertising offers quick results, but Organic SEO builds trust, authority, and sustainable rankings, making it a cost-effective strategy for long-term digital marketing success.
